curl_multi for Indy(IdHTTP)?

时间:2012-12-05 01:31:23

标签: delphi curl delphi-xe2 libcurl indy

如何使用Indy IdHTTP在Delphi中进行curl_multi?我的意思是多个请求,就像在PHP中一样...但是我不会使用cURL而是使用Indy。

  

Curl_multi基本上是在单个线程中并行的多个HTTP请求

它也可以是任何其他库。据我所知,CurlPas自2005年以来一直没有更新。

由于

1 个答案:

答案 0 :(得分:2)

使用IdHTTP的多个实例,每个实例都在自己的线程中。

更新

澄清:创建一个TThread子类。在TThread执行中,选取一个请求的URL,创建一个IdHttp并为其提供服务。你可以让多个这样的线程并行运行。这意味着您的HTTP请求将被并行处理,就像卷曲一样。